Transaction 538596afcaaf5c70849a44f50a1808776b6380bd222ff9526f32af4b60538175
1 Input
1 Output
-
538596afcaaf5c70849a44f50a1808776b6380bd222ff9526f32af4b60538175:0
- value
- 1383135
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 75ea695223d43246098a898b2aab605fc4e90207d88e8025a504ef6600871110
- address
- bc1pwh4xj53r6seyvzv23x9j42mqtlzwjqs8mz8gqfd9qnhkvqy8zygqw2fzqu